How AT&T is Mastering Global IoT

Global IoT connectivity stands at a transformative crossroads. The traditional model of operator-specific SIMs and roaming agreements no longer meets the demands of modern IoT deployments. A new paradigm is emerging, driven by the need for true global connectivity and localization.


Mike Van Horn, AT&T’s Area Vice President, Product Development & Management, Internet of Things, joins the podcast to discuss how eSIM orchestration and federated localization are reshaping IoT connectivity. Mike explores the evolution from traditional roaming to automated eSIM management, the importance of device expertise, and why localization matters more than ever. The conversation delves into key topics, including:


  • How eSIM orchestration enables global deployments
  • What AT&T and Eseye’s announcement at MWC25 means
  • The purpose and benefits of AT&T’s Global SIM Advanced solution
  • Why device optimization remains critical


This episode examines the future of IoT connectivity and how eSIM orchestration and embedded advanced automation rules will drive the next wave of IoT connectivity innovation. Tune in to understand the technology transforming global IoT deployments.
